PUBLIC NOTICE

Morrow County is seeking a volunteer to represent the Boardman area on the Morrow County Planning Commission. Planning Commission volunteers serve four-year terms. This recruitment is to fill a term that began on January 1, 2025, and has recently reopened.

The Planning Commission generally meets once a month, alternating meeting locations between Heppner and Irrigon. As part of the Planning Commission the duties include reviewing land use applications, maintaining the county's subdivision and zoning ordinances, and working with the County staff to maintain the county's Comprehensive Land Use Plan.

Interested parties residing in Morrow County who are interested in taking a more active part in land use planning in the county are encouraged to submit a letter of interest to the Morrow County Planning Department, PO Box 40, Irrigon OR 97844, by 5 pm Thursday, July 3, 2025.

DATED this 28th day of May 2025

2024 Legal Notice of
Unclaimed Capital Credits

Oregon Trail Electric Cooperative (OTEC) hereby gives notice of UNCLAIMED PAYMENTS OF CAPITAL CREDITS.

Pursuant to OTEC bylaws and policy, the names of OTEC Members who are entitled to capital credit retirements – but have not yet claimed their retirements – can be reviewed on the OTEC website.

If you are an OTEC member and current (or former) OTEC consumer, please visit www.otec.coop/capital-credits to search the list of Unclaimed Capital Credits. Members who have unclaimed capital credits may complete the Unclaimed Capital Credits form available at www.otec.coop/capital-credits.

Application for re-issuing funds owed may also be made at your local OTEC office or 4005 23rd Street, Baker City, Oregon 97814. Unless those persons named, or their heirs, claim payment no later than November 29, 2024, for unclaimed capital credits that have been available for a period of four years, or December 31, 2019, the unclaimed funds may be forfeited to the Cooperative. The Board of Directors has the discretion to contribute all, or a portion, of the forfeited funds to the Oregon Trail Electric Cooperative Scholarship Fund to benefit those served by the Cooperative.

If you have questions or need assistance, please contact OTEC at 541-523-3616.
